This typeface presents a clean, contemporary sans with smooth, rounded curves and restrained stroke modulation. Proportions are balanced and fairly open, with generous counters in letters like O, P, and e, supporting clarity at text sizes. Terminals tend to finish softly (often with a subtle rounding) rather than sharp cuts, while diagonals in A, V, W, and y feel crisp and controlled. Overall spacing and rhythm read even, producing a calm, orderly texture in paragraph settings.

Round forms are notably smooth and consistent, and the lowercase shows straightforward, text-friendly construction (single-storey a and g, simple i/j dots). Numerals appear clear and unshowy, matching the overall restrained, functional voice.
